DiGiovanni Draws CACC Player of the Week Award
                                                                                                                   
New Haven, Conn. – (9/16/2013) – Senior forward Carly DiGiovanni (Seaville, N.J.) tallied three goals this week, including two amidst Chestnut Hill College’s 5-1 second half run at Post University on Sunday, September 15, to earn herself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) Player of the Week honors. DiGiovanni registered her first goal of the week as the Griffins only goal against Bloomsburg University, on Tuesday, September 10.
 
As time ticked off the game clock on Victory Field #1, the intensity picked up on the turf with Chestnut Hill College (1-3, 1-0) and Bloomsburg University battling through a full extra frame before junior midfielder Julia Rios (Millersville, Pa.) scored the game-winner at 107:50. DiGiovanni gave the Griffins the initial lead when she found the back of the net off a pass from her classmate, midfielder Marykate McShane (Lebanon, Pa.) at 55:27. Unfortunately, the Huskies retaliated less than four minutes later, 1-1 (59:14), tying the affair and later stealing victory in a 2-1 double overtime final.
 
It was a big day for the Griffin offense on Sunday, September 15, as they erupted for five second-half goals in a 5-2 CACC victory at Post University. DiGiovanni scored twice in the Griffins second-half run that also included goals from junior Kelly McKenna (Dover, Del.), McShane (Lebanon, Pa.) and sophomore defender Christina Mangeri (Muttontown, N.Y.). The Eagles had grabbed an early lead at 3:28, 1-0, but the Griffins denied the Eagles any additional breathing room before McShane ignited the offense just after halftime, 1-1 (45:58). Her unassisted tally was followed by three more great individual Griffin efforts, McKenna at 46:42, 2-1, and DiGiovanni twice, first at 49:17, 3-1, and again at 54:52, 4-1. A second home tally looked to get the Eagles back in the game, but Griffins regained composure and fended off the Eagles before junior midfielder Morgan Fell (Boyertown, Pa.) found Mangeri for a last-minute insurance goal at 89:02, 5-2.
 
The women's soccer team plays their next CACC contest on Saturday, September 21, when they visit Felician College for a 5:30 p.m. kickoff.
